Bet Tzedek Legal Services
Staff Attorney II, Transgender Advocacy
Bet Tzedek Legal Services, Los Angeles, California, United States, 90079
Overview
Bet Tzedek seeks a determined, organized, and zealous advocate for a temporary position assisting transgender individuals seeking legal remedies regarding gender-affirming identification and healthcare, discrimination, and/or harassment. This position focuses on providing legal services and advocacy to transgender and gender nonconforming individuals in Southern California. The Transgender Rights Project assists individuals in correcting legal name and gender markers for full participation in the community with dignity. The staff attorney provides advocacy for individuals facing denials of medically necessary gender-affirming healthcare.
This position is eligible for Bet Tzedek Legal Services’ hybrid/remote workplace designation. At the discretion of the immediate supervisor, the employee may be required to work in the office or other locations to meet workload/business obligations. This requirement may be on a temporary or ongoing basis.
Location: Los Angeles, CA. Salary range: $85,305.32-$104,240.28 (DOE/DOQ).
Essential Duties
Conduct intakes of potential clients and litigants.
Assist individuals who have experienced denials of gender-affirming medical treatment through a mix of advice and counsel, limited scope services, insurance appeals, and/or representation in California’s Independent Medical Review process.
Manage the execution of legal name and gender marker change clinics serving pro se litigants.
Present trainings to prepare pro bono attorneys and volunteers for participation in virtual, in-house, and community-based legal name and gender marker change clinics.
Prepare matters for pro bono placement, monitor status of placements, and provide technical support to pro bono attorneys.
Address health-harming legal needs through advocacy utilizing laws mandating coverage for medically necessary gender-affirming health care.
